Jicama Salad W/ Lime Juice & Fresh Mint

ingredients
- 1 medium jicama,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ch, cubes or 1 1/2-2 lbs jicama
- 2 teaspoons extra virgin olive oil
- 3 tablespoons fresh lime juice
- 3⁄4 teaspoon dried chipotle powder or 1 1/2 teaspoons dried ancho chile powder
- 1⁄2 teaspoon salt
- 25 fresh mint leaves, cut into thin strips
- 2 2 tablespoons feta or 2 tablespoons goat cheese
directions
- Combine jicama and oil in a bowl and toss well.
- Add lime juice chili powder, and salt. Toss to coat.
- Divide salad among 4 small bowls, then sprinkle each with 1/4 of the mint and cheese right before serving.
